Blackmagic 3G-SDI Arduino Shield lets customers build their own custom controllers for cameras and other SDI devices. It is a small expansion board that connects to an Arduino, which is an extremely popular open-source electronics prototyping platform.
The Blackmagic 3G-SDI Shield for Arduino is a small expansion board that connects to an Arduino, which is an extremely popular open-source electronics prototyping platform. You can build custom controllers for Blackmagic cameras using the SDI camera control protocol! Use the sample code to learn how Arduino communicates with the shield, to send commands to cameras and other SDI devices! When you combine the power of camera control using the Blackmagic 3G-SDI Shield for Arduino and then use an Arduino Ethernet shield to control routers and switchers, you get everything you need to build complex automation and broadcast control solutions.
